Examining object recognition and object-in-Place memory in plateau zokors, Eospalax baileyi.

Abstract

Recognition memory is important for the survival and fitness of subterranean rodents due to the barren underground conditions that require avoiding the burden of higher energy costs or possible conflict with conspecifics. Our study aims to examine the object and object/place recognition memories in plateau zokors (Eospalax baileyi) and test whether their underground life exerts sex-specific differences in memory functions using Novel Object Recognition (NOR) and Object-in-Place (OiP) paradigms. Animals were tested in the NOR with short (10min) and long-term (24h) inter-trial intervals (ITI) and in the OiP for a 30-min ITI between the familiarization and testing sessions. Plateau zokors showed a strong preference for novel objects manifested by a longer exploration time for the novel object after 10min ITI but failed to remember the familiar object when tested after 24h, suggesting a lack of long-term memory. In the OiP test, zokors effectively formed an association between the objects and the place where they were formerly encountered, resulting in a higher duration of exploration to the switched objects. However, both sexes showed equivalent results in exploration time during the NOR and OiP tests, which eliminates the possibility of discovering sex-specific variations in memory performance. Taken together, our study illustrates robust novelty preference and an effective short-term recognition memory without marked sex-specific differences, which might elucidate the dynamics of recognition memory formation and retrieval in plateau zokors.

摘要

由于地下环境贫瘠,需要避免更高的能量消耗负担或与同种个体发生冲突,识别记忆对地下啮齿动物的生存和适应性很重要。我们的研究旨在检查高原鼢鼠(甘肃鼢鼠)的物体识别和物体/地点识别记忆,并使用新颖物体识别(NOR)和物体在位(OiP)范式测试它们的地下生活是否在记忆功能上产生性别特异性差异。动物在NOR中分别以短(10分钟)和长(24小时)的试验间隔(ITI)进行测试,在OiP中,在熟悉和测试环节之间有30分钟的ITI。高原鼢鼠对新颖物体表现出强烈偏好,在10分钟ITI后对新颖物体的探索时间更长,但在24小时后测试时未能记住熟悉的物体,这表明缺乏长期记忆。在OiP测试中,鼢鼠有效地在物体和它们之前遇到的地点之间形成了关联,导致对切换物体的探索时间更长。然而,在NOR和OiP测试中,两性在探索时间上的结果相当,这排除了发现记忆表现中性别特异性差异的可能性。综上所述,我们的研究表明了强烈的新颖性偏好和有效的短期识别记忆,且没有明显的性别特异性差异,这可能阐明了高原鼢鼠识别记忆形成和检索的动态过程。
